Taula de continguts:

BMP280 + 5110 LCD Arduino: 5 passos
BMP280 + 5110 LCD Arduino: 5 passos

Vídeo: BMP280 + 5110 LCD Arduino: 5 passos

Vídeo: BMP280 + 5110 LCD Arduino: 5 passos
Vídeo: Обзор модуля BMP280 Датчик атмосферного давления для arduino 2024, De novembre
Anonim
BMP280 + 5110 LCD Arduino
BMP280 + 5110 LCD Arduino

Hola món!

Acabo de passar un cap de setmana llarg i després d’acabar amb la meva soldadura electrònica em vaig fer una idea. Tinc uns quants sensors BMP280 que he ordenat per error, però no els he utilitzat durant un temps. Es tracta d’un esbós molt senzill per mesurar les dades de pressió baromètrica i temperatura.

Comencem!

Pas 1: les parts que necessiteu

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u
Les parts que necessiteu

Les parts que necessiteu per a aquest projecte:

1 X Arduino Uno (per exemple: Robotdyn Uno)

1 X tauler de pa

1 X Nokia 5110 LCD

1 sensor BMP280

I alguns cables de pont.

Pas 2: el pinout

Pantalla LCD Nokia 5110:

RST: digital 12

CE: Digital 11

DC: digital 10

DIN: digital 9

CLK: digital 8

VCC: Arduino de 3 volts

LLUM: terra Arduino (si voleu retroiluminació)

GND: terra Arduino

BMP280:

VIN: Arduino de 3 o 5 volts

GND: terra Arduino

SCL: Arduino Analog 5

SDA: Arduino Analog 4

O el pinout SCA SDA dedicat al vostre arduino, si la placa els té.

Pas 3: el codi

1. Col·loqueu-lo a la carpeta Arduino sketches o biblioteques.

2. Descarregueu les biblioteques correctes que s'inclouen a l'esbós.

3. Col·loqueu-los a les biblioteques anteriors.

4. Obriu el codi a l'IDE Arduino.

5. Compila-ho.

6. Pengeu-lo al vostre Arduino.

Pas 4: Informació bàsica

Informació bàsica!
Informació bàsica!

Per obtenir la pressió baromètrica correcta, modifiqueu (bme.readPressure () / 98.7); a l’esbós.

Tot i així, podeu obtenir ajuda de les dades baromètriques de l’estació de forcast de waether local per obtenir resultats precisos.

La mesura de la temperatura no és molt precisa amb aquest sensor. Si no voleu mesurar la temperatura, descomenteu-la al codi.

Espero que us agradi i en feu un bon ús.

Si us plau, no dubteu a utilitzar aquest codi o fer-lo avançar.

Pas 5: un prototip compacte

Un prototip compacte!
Un prototip compacte!

Si voleu un projecte més petit, encara podeu utilitzar una placa PCB amb un xip Atmega328P-Pu independent amb alguns cables i una mica de temps per soldar-lo junts.

Recomanat: